      ab: Objective: This article introduces an alternative to the classic flowable injection technique to enhance esthetic outcomes and describes its application for the restoration of six maxillary anterior teeth in a young patient. Clinical Considerations: An esthetically enhanced flowable injection technique was applied to six maxillary anterior teeth after a fully digital treatment plan. A virtually guided dentin cutback model was created from the digital full wax up. Clear polyvinyl siloxane indices were created from three different 3D‐printed models: one from the dentin cutback model of all teeth, one from the enamel model with every other tooth waxed up completely in an alternating sequence, and the third one from the enamel wax up model of all teeth. The two different enamel models are only necessary when multiple anterior teeth are restored to simplify interproximal contouring and control. The multilayer approach enhances esthetic outcomes of direct resin‐based flowable composite restorations without any or only minimal tooth preparation. Conclusions: The multilayer injection technique facilitates predictable transfer of the digitally planned dentin and enamel tooth structure shapes and volumes to the patient's mouth to fabricate highly esthetic and minimally invasive direct restorations with flowable resin‐based composites. Clinical Significance: The precise transfer of the digital tooth and/or smile design with the updated flowable injection technique allows the clinician to fabricate esthetic restorations in a most predictable and tooth‐structure‐preserving manner.
